Why did apache not build hogans like the Navajo
Lostsunrise [7]
A hogan is more of a permanent home, it takes a lot more time and materials to build. The Navajo are people that had kept sheep and goat, they mostly lived at between 5000 and 8000 feet in elevation. Some apache did make make hogans but they also used tipis. Apaches live a more mobile life style so other types of houses were more useful.

Which factors led to the Great Depression
Vaselesa [24]
The stock market crash of 1929; the collapse of world trade due to the Smoot-Hawley Tariff (Hawley, it was signed by President Herbert Hoover on June 17, 1930. The act raised US tariffs on over 20,000 imported goods. The tariffs under the act, excluding duty-free imports were the second highest in United States history, exceeded by only the Tariff of 1828), government policies; bank failures and panics; and the collapse of the money supply.
